As of 2009, there were fewer than 200 pediatric neurosurgeons in the United States. Approximately 80% of them were male. In the past 25 years, 391 doctors graduated from a pediatric neurosurgery program. Only 70% of them currently practice primarily pediatric rather than adult neurosurgery.
